Binding Over Orders:

 He finds it impossible to decide who is in the wrong, and so he orders both Mr. A and Mr. B to be bound over. Naturally, both Mr. A and Mr. B are furious with the outcome since they interpret the binding-over order as a finding of guilt. In addition, binding-over orders are often used against peeping toms, poison-pen writers, and rejected suitors who will not take ‘no’ for an answer. About eight thousand orders a year are made under the 1361 Act.

Before a convicted person is sentenced, he (or his attorney at law in Pakistan or an Advocate in Pakistan) can make a speech in mitigation to the court. The purpose of comfort is to persuade the court to impose a lighter sentence than it might otherwise have done. It is not an occasion for the defendant to repeat, I didn’t do it; it is too late to argue about guilt, for the only matter to be decided is the sentence.

There are Two Elementary Rules of Mitigation:

Do not say too much as Wilfred Fordham QC has put it, ‘pleas in mitigation do not get any better the longer they go on. Do not call too many character witnesses. Usually, one will suffice.
